Active, through-hole 8-DIP.","metaKeywords":null},"attributes":{"series":null,"packageCase":null,"mountingType":null,"rohsStatus":"ROHS3 Compliant","productStatus":"Active","categoryPath":["Analog & Data Acquisition"],"specifications":{"Package":"Tube","Gate Type":"N-Channel, P-Channel MOSFET","Input Type":"Inverting","Channel Type":"Independent","Mounting Type":"Through Hole","Package / Case":"8-DIP (0.300\\\", 7.62mm)","lifecycle_stage":"eol_hot","Voltage - Supply":"5V ~ 40V","Number of Drivers":"2","Driven Configuration":"Low-Side","Operating Temperature":"0°C ~ 70°C (TA)","Rise / Fall Time (Typ)":"20ns, 20ns","Supplier Device Package":"8-PDIP","Logic Voltage - VIL, VIH":"0.8V, 2.2V","Current - Peak Output (Source, Sink)":"1.5A, 1.5A"}},"commercial":{"minOrderQty":null,"leadTime":null,"referencePrice":"$12.57","stockQuantity":0,"priceTiers":[{"qty":1,"price":"$12.57000","currency":"USD"},{"qty":10,"price":"$11.35200","currency":"USD"},{"qty":25,"price":"$10.82360","currency":"USD"},{"qty":100,"price":"$9.39820","currency":"USD"},{"qty":250,"price":"$8.97576","currency":"USD"},{"qty":500,"price":"$8.18378","currency":"USD"},{"qty":1000,"price":"$7.47150","currency":"USD"}]},"links":{"datasheetUrl":"https://cdn.icboms.com/1a52bf5bcf082fbceb65a3b297fb3c91.pdf","sourceUrl":null},"ai":{"faq":[{"question":"What are the alternatives to UC3709N?","answer":"A functional alternative is the LM5106MM/NOPB, which is also a dual low-side driver but with non-inverting inputs, half-bridge configuration, and a wider -40°C to 125°C temperature range. The LM5106 comes in surface-mount packages only (no DIP), so it is not a pin-compatible drop-in for the UC3709N. For a through-hole replacement, the Microchip TC4427 or TC4428 series in 8-DIP is worth evaluating — same pin count, similar 1.5A drive strength, but check the supply range and logic thresholds against your design."},{"question":"What gate types does the UC3709N support?","answer":"The UC3709N drives both N-channel and P-channel MOSFETs. Each of the two independent channels can handle either polarity, giving you flexibility to drive a synchronous rectifier pair or two independent low-side switches from one driver IC."}],"compareFactBullets":[],"relatedMpns":[],"engineerNotes":[],"selectionNotes":null,"limitations":null},"provenance":{"sourceSystem":"icboms-matrix-langgraph","citationUrl":"https://icboms.com/texas-instruments/UC3709N","citationPolicyUrl":"https://icboms.com/llms.txt","source":"ICBOMS","attribution":"Open for AI and search answers: credit \"ICBOMS\" and link https://icboms.com/texas-instruments/UC3709N when reusing this data.
